Checking Your Current Address Settings
To start, open the Google Home app on your smartphone or tablet. Tap on your account in the bottom right corner, then select “Settings.” From there, choose the device you want to edit the address for. Next, click on “More,” then “Device settings,” followed by “Location.”
Editing Your Address
Once you’re in the “Location” section, you can edit your address by clicking on “Set address.” Enter the accurate address details of your desired location. Make sure to double-check for any typos or errors to ensure precision.
Verifying Changes
After inputting the new address details, click on “Save.” Google Home will then verify the changes to confirm that the address is accurate. This step is crucial in ensuring that the device recognizes the location correctly.
Testing the Address
To ensure that your Google Home now directs you to the right address, give it a command like, “Hey Google, navigate home.” Verify that the device accurately identifies and navigates to the set location.
Troubleshooting
If Google Home still directs you to the wrong address after editing, double-check the address details you entered. Make sure they match the intended destination. If the issue persists, restart your Google Home device and try the editing process again.

Steps to Update Google Home Address
Here are the straightforward steps you can follow to update your Google Home address accurately:
- Open Google Home App: Launch the Google Home app on your mobile device. Ensure you’re signed in to the Google account linked to your Google Home device.
- Access Device Settings: Tap on the device for which you want to update the address. This will open the device settings menu.
- Select Device Address: Look for the “Device Address” option within the device settings. Tap on it to view and edit the current address details.
- Edit Address Details: Review the current address saved in the device settings. If it’s incorrect or needs updating, tap on the “Edit” button next to the address.
- Enter New Address: Input the new address accurately in the provided fields. Double-check the address for any errors before saving the changes.
- Save Changes: Once you’ve entered the correct address details, save the changes by selecting the “Save” or “Update” option, depending on the app interface.
- Verification: After saving the new address, ensure the changes are reflected correctly. Confirm that the address is updated to the desired location.
- Test Accuracy: Test the accuracy of the updated address by giving voice commands related to navigation or location-based queries on your Google Home device.
- Troubleshooting: If you encounter any issues with the updated address, consider restarting your Google Home device or repeating the address update process to rectify any errors.

How can I edit my address accurately on Google Home?
To edit your address accurately on Google Home, open the Google Home app, tap on your profile picture, select Assistant settings, navigate to Home address, and update the address details. Ensure the address is correct for accurate navigation.
